2010-11 was successful season for Thaddeus Young
Thaddeus Young's fourth NBA season has been much better than his third. Young, a high-energy reserve forward, struggled finding a role with Eddie Jordan on the 27-55 Sixers of 2009-10. Afterward, he said he wanted to throw the whole season "out the window." This year, under Doug Collins, he finished third in the NBA Sixth Man of the Year balloting and the Sixers went 41-41, earning the Eastern Conference's seventh playoff seed. Philly Burbs
